Transaction c788633cbcfd86944082724fb39b6a5e217c7fc4da3372888e58e31d8018ec84
1 Input
1 Output
-
c788633cbcfd86944082724fb39b6a5e217c7fc4da3372888e58e31d8018ec84:0
- value
- 1696035
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f6742dae5b621c5390a870e24e24793f9c22f91
- address
- bc1qhan59kh9kcsu2wg2su8zfcj8j0uuytu32wxe7r